Name
parallel_reduce<Range,Body> Template Function — Computes reduction over a range of values.
Synopsis
#include "tbb/parallel_reduce.h" template<typename Range, typename Body> void parallel_reduce( const Range& range, Body& body ); template<typename Range, typename Body, typename Partitioner> void parallel_reduce( const Range& range, Body& body, Partitioner &partitioner );
Description
A parallel_reduce<Range,Body>
performs parallel reduction of Body
over each value in Range
. Type Range
must model the Range Concept. The body must model the requirements in Table 3-7.

A parallel_reduce
recursively splits the range into subranges to the point where is_divisible()
returns false
for each subrange. A parallel_reduce
uses the splitting constructor to make one or more copies of the body for each thread. It may copy a body while the body’s operator()
or join
method runs concurrently. You are responsible for ensuring the safety of such concurrency. In typical usage, the safety requires no extra effort.
